Well, I'm at 7-11 this afternoon buying drinks for me and the kid (evil, thy name is "IBC Root Beer on tap at 7-11"), and I spied something nifty-looking: the fine people at Reese's, who have been doing variations on their classic Peanut Butter Cup for several years now (White Chocolate cups, Inside-Out cups, Big Cups, et cetera) now have a "Peanut Butter Lover's" limited edition out. Did I buy them? Oh, you bet.

And is it as good as the Boyer Peanut Butter Smoothie? Oh, it's so damned close...but no.

It's a really good item. I plan to fill my fridge with the things. But no, they're not replacing the Boyer delicacy, because Reese's just couldn't get beyond the idea that there had to be chocolate in this thing, somewhere -- so the bottom and sides of the cup are chocolate. There's the same peanut butter filling, and the "lid" of the cup is a peanut-butter shell, but there's still chocolate there. It's almost like someone at Reese's chickened out -- "It can't be all peanut butter! Who'd buy that!" -- and so, well, it looks like the small candy company from Altoona is still the king of Peanut Butter Cup World, as far as I am concerned.
